Need Help Now? Crisis & Emergency Resources

If you are experiencing a mental health crisis or emergency, please know that you are not alone.  Help is available.  We've compiled a list of resources that can provide immediate support and assistance.  Please use these resources if you need urgent help, and don't hesitate to reach out to a trusted friend, family member, or mental health professional.

988 Suicide & Crisis Lifeline

Call or text 988. This service provides 24/7, free and confidential support for people in distress. They can also help those who are worried about a loved one who may need crisis support. 988lifeline.org

Crisis Text Line

Text HOME to 741741 from anywhere in the US, anytime, about any type of crisis. A live, trained Crisis Counselor receives the text and responds, all on a secure online platform. crisistextline.org

The Trevor Project

A national 24-hour, toll-free confidential suicide hotline for LGBTQ young people.  Phone: 1-866-488-7386, Text: START to 678678, thetrevorproject.org

National Domestic Violence Hotline

Provides confidential support to victims of domestic violence. Phone: 1-800-799-7233  thehotline.org

National Sexual Assault Hotline (RAINN)

Confidential support for survivors of sexual assault. Phone: 1-800-656-HOPE

The Jed Foundation

Dedicated to protecting emotional health and preventing suicide for teens and young adults. jedfoundation.org

Childhelp USA

Provides support for victims of child abuse. Phone: 1-800-422-4453 or childhelp.org

SAMHSA’s National Helpline

Provides referrals to local treatment facilities, support groups, and community-based organizations. Phone: 1-800-662-HELP (4357) samhsa.gov
